We're thinking of moving to Epsom. Seen a great family house on a lovely road but bit nervous about moving from trendy south east london to surburbia.

As mum to be, just want to reassure myself that there is a community feel in Epsom for youngish 30 something mums. What is there to - do locally?

Any details that reassure would be gratefully appreciated - does Epsom have a trendy side?

Hi, I've been living in Epsom for nearly 4 years and my DS is almost 2 months. I was working up to Christmas and didn't know anyone locally with kids but that's changed thanks to NCT and local NHS antenatal group where I've met some other new Mums.

Expect that it's not as trendy here as where you are at the moment but there's lots of 30 something Mums locally, including me!, quite a few playgroups and babies/toddlers activities and the usual coffee places like Starbucks which are usually busy with Mums and LOs during the week! I used to live in South Croydon and also in Sutton and definitely prefer it here - nicer place for LOs.
